| Jesse Lynch has over 30 years of experience in the educational arena. His degrees in Elementary Education and Elementary Administration from Indiana State University and Ball State University prepared him to serve both as a teacher and an administrator in the Indianapolis Public Schools system. Mr. Lynch is a member of the Omega Psi Phi Fraternity and he is an avid golfer. His service to the community has involved officiating in the boy's basketball State Finals in 1983. Mr. Lynch is retired from his position as the Regional Director for the Manual Boundary. |

Tom Shevlot is a Lawrence Township resident who was born and raised in Indianapolis. He graduated from Indianapolis Baptist High School and received his B.A. from Taylor University and an M.B.A. from Kennedy Western University. Mr. Shevlot's professional career spans over 20 years in various management and leadership positions, primarily with AT&T. He currently manages AT&T's Indiana and Michigan consumer retail sales division. Prior to re-joining AT&T in 2007, he served two years as Comcast's Vice President for Northeast Indiana. Mr. Shevlot's 25-year civic involvement has included serving on local boards such as the Special Olympics, the Chamber of Commerce Economic Council and the American Heart Association. He also has served as a basketball coach for the Indianapolis YMCA, president of the Heritage Christian High School Athletic Booster Club, and other assorted community activities. Mr. Shevlot and his wife, Elizabeth, a CPA at KPMG, have two children, Alex and Emily. |

Mr. Bacon’s commitment to local civic involvement spans 27 years and includes, among other volunteer activities, work with the Martin Luther King, Jr. Community Center of Indianapolis, the Martin Luther King, Jr. Community Development Corporation and the Douglass Juniors Golf Program. He is an Indianapolis Outstanding Volunteer recipient and co-founder of the Martin Luther King, Jr. Community Development Corporation, as well as an Indiana Black Expo Outstanding Volunteer recipient. Mr. Bacon has held board positions and memberships in numerous civic, fraternal and dance organizations. A graduate of Arsenal Technical High School in Indianapolis and Tennessee State University, Mr. Bacon received a Masters in Project Management from ITT. He currently serves as Manufacturing Engineer with Allison Transmission Div./GM, where he has worked since 1973. Mr. Bacon is an avid golfer and ballroom dancer and enjoys listening to smooth jazz. |

| Scott Evenbeck grew up in Fostoria, Ohio. He earned his AB in Psychology at Indiana University and his MA and PhD in Social Psychology at the University of North Carolina at Chapel Hill. He joined the Psychology faculty of IUPUI in 1972 where he is now Professor of Psychology and Dean of University College. He is a national leader in developing and assessing programs to support entering university students and in general education and assessment. He has served as President of the Association for Continuing Higher Education, Vice President of Alpha Sigma Lambda's national board, and the Board of the National Resource Center for First-year Students and Students in Transition and is currently on the Board of the American Conference of Academic Deans. He has also served as President of the American Lung Association of Indiana and of the Consortium of Endowed Episcopal Parishes. He is on the Board of the Indianapolis Urban League and of the Indianapolis Art Center. He is Secretary of the Episcopal Diocese of Indianapolis and has served as a Deputy to General Convention since 1991 where he Chairs the House of Deputies Committee on Education. |

| Jim Lingenfelter is a member of the American Institute of Architects and owner of Five2Five, a design-oriented firm that provides planning and architectural services for different types of projects. Mr. Lingenfelter received a B.S. in Environmental Design and a Bachelor of Architecture from Ball State University. Mr. Lingenfelter has vast experience as Project Architect or Manager for numerous Indianapolis and central Indiana building projects, including IPS School 54 and the Garfield Parks Arts Center. His community involvement includes service on the boards of the East Tenth Street Civic Association, Fletcher Place Neighborhood Association and Meridian-Kessler Neighborhood Association, and participation in the Urban Design Guidelines Oversight Committee and the Regional Center Update Committees 2020 plan. |

| Mr. Meyer is President of Square One, Inc., a consulting practice specializing in government and regulatory affairs liaison services to various clients. Prior to forming Square One, Inc. in 1990, he was the Director of Administration at the Indianapolis Center for Advanced Research. Mr. Meyer received his B.S. degree in Environmental Science from the University of Wisconsin-Green Bay and an M.S. degree in Agronomy and an M.S. degree in Public Policy and Administration both from Purdue University. |

| Marie Turner-Wright was named Librarian Emeritus at Indiana University in 2001 following a 20-year career of service at University Library, IUPUI and teaching positions throughout the I.U. system. Ms. Turner-Wright earned an A.B. in the College of Arts and Sciences, and a M.L.S. and Sp.L.I.S. in the School of Library and Information Science at I.U. Ms. Turner-Wright began her career at IMCPL, where she served as Manager of the Emerson Branch from 1974-1979. Recently included in Marquis "Who’s Who in America,” Ms. Turner-Wright has served on the governing body of the American Library Association, and has been a member of the Association for the Study of African-American Life and History, Inc., the Children’s Literature Association, the Freedom to Read Foundation and the Indiana Library Federation. She is a past Board member of the Writers’ Center of Indianapolis. |
